Output 81c8a3bfdff487c4dbccb580557d5dcbf7cd9a7e41e21b2e2c4f482d5c1c39e8:0

value
32746762
script pubkey
OP_0 OP_PUSHBYTES_20 ca630149662b7fa9afee5430079f615feb97b645
address
bc1qef3szjtx9dl6ntlw2scq08mptl4e0dj96auz7m
transaction
81c8a3bfdff487c4dbccb580557d5dcbf7cd9a7e41e21b2e2c4f482d5c1c39e8
spent
true